Keep individual SXW files under 250 MB for fastest conversions; larger documents significantly increase memory and processing time.
To preserve visual fidelity, export pages at higher DPI (300–600 DPI) and choose 32-bit RGB PFM rather than grayscale when color accuracy matters.
For batch conversion, split large multi-page SXW files into per-page exports or use a tool that supports queueing; monitor disk space because PFM files are large.
Note format limitation: SXW is a document format and does not natively store HDR pixel data — conversion rasterizes pages into PFM, so vector editability is lost.
